The success of a man is the outcome of his decisions and audacity to take on the risk to make his own way. My journey is nothing more extraordinary than yours. Hailed from a middle-class family in a suburb of U.P. Chose the easiest path of life as an EPBX executive in an organisation. But I soon realised that this is not what I am made for. I started my venture in 1991 from a PCO business with as much as Rs. 15,000 borrowed from my friends and family. Years of struggle and relentless effort finally paved my way until 1995, when I faced a downturn in business. In the year 2012, I ventured again into a new sector, a new beginning but with no capital, experience or backup plan. People bet on my failure, but I proved them wrong and turned the fortune to favour me again. Today I am a sportsperson, entrepreneur, coach and motivational speaker.
